Bendamustine: Uses, Side Effects & Warnings

Generic name: bendamustine [ ben-da-mus-teen ] Drug class: Alkylating agents Pregnancy & Lactation: Risk data available What is Bendamustine? Bendamustine is used to treat chronic lymphocytic leukemia. Bendamustine is also used to treat indolent B-cell non-Hodgkin lymphoma after other medicines have been tried without successful treatment of this condition. Bendamustine may also be used for purposes not listed in this medication guide. Warnings Tell your caregivers right away if you have any type of skin rash after being treated with bendamustine. Dapsone (systemic) (monograph): Uses, Side Effects & Warnings

Generic name: medically reviewed Pregnancy & Lactation: Risk data available What is Dapsone (systemic) (monograph)? Introduction Antimycobacterial; antiprotozoal; sulfone. Uses for Dapsone (Systemic) Leprosy Treatment of leprosy (Hansen's disease) in conjunction with other anti-infectives. WHO and US National Hansen's Disease Program (NHDP) recommend multidrug therapy (MDT) for treatment of all forms of leprosy, including multibacillary leprosy and paucibacillary leprosy. MDT regimens can rapidly kill Mycobacterium leprae , render patient noninfectious after only a few days of treatment, delay or prevent emergence of resistant M. leprae , and reduce risk of relapse after treatment discontinuance. Dinoprostone topical: Uses, Side Effects & Warnings

Generic name: dinoprostone topical [ dye-no-pros-tone-top-ik-al ] Drug class: Uterotonic agents Pregnancy & Lactation: Risk data available What is Dinoprostone topical? Dinoprostone is a prostaglandin, a hormone-like substance that is naturally produced by tissues in the body. Dinoprostone topical is used in a pregnant woman to relax the muscles of the cervix (opening of the uterus) in preparation for inducing labor at the end of a pregnancy. Dinoprostone topical may be used for purposes not listed in this medication guide. Factor viia (recombinant) (monograph): Uses, Side Effects & Warnings

Generic name: novoseven rt What is Factor viia (recombinant) (monograph)? Warning Risk of serious arterial and venous thromboembolic adverse events, particularly when factor VIIa (recombinant) is used outside FDA-labeled indications. (See Thromboembolic Events under Cautions.) Both fatal and nonfatal thromboembolic events have been reported in clinical studies and during postmarketing experience. Discuss risk of thromboembolism with patient. Monitor for signs and symptoms of coagulation system activation and thrombosis during therapy. Introduction Biosynthetic preparation (recombinant DNA origin) of blood coagulation factor VIIa.
